Google wants a NEST in your home

Last week, Google purchased NEST - the startup company that makes the trendy Learning Thermostat and Protect Smoke Detectors, for $3.2 BILLION. Yes, you heard that right. That's a lot of money. Facebook is Still the King of Social Media Referrals

It may not come as a big surprise, but in Shareaholic's Q4 2013 Report, Facebook accounted for just over 15% of all inbound referrals from social media (including direct traffic, social referrals, and searching) to the over 200,000 sites that are part of the Shareaholic network.
